Product Documentation
Congestion Analysis Task Assistant
Product Version IC23.1, June 2023

How do I create a global bias negative region constraint?

A global bias negative region constraint acts as a magnet that can repel a group of nets and buses out of a region during global routing. The biased nets take priority in being pushed out of the bias region. This can result in the routing for the biased nets becoming more circuitous. Another way to conceptualize the negative bias region is as a soft blockage for a selected set of nets.
To create a global bias negative region:

  1. Select a net, group of nets, or a bus from the Navigator assistant. 
  2. Click the Global Bias Setup icon on the Congestion Analysis assistant toolbar.
    The Global Bias Setup form displays. 
  3. Click the New button to create a new global bias constraint group.
    A group is created and assigned a name by default. The name can be a number in a series starting from GB00. Also, the net selected in the Navigator assistant appears in the Nets list box.
  4. Add and remove nets in the Global Bias Setup form.
  5. To edit the global bias constraint group name, click in the Global Bias text field and specify another name.
  6. To add a negative bias region, click the + Rectangles button.
  7. Click and drag to draw a region in the heat map. The region created on the heat map is used as the coordinates for the Bias Area. 
    The bias area is automatically assigned a name by default. The name can be a number in a series starting from vsrGlobalBias_AB_00 and is displayed in the Bias Areas list box. 
  8. Click the green ± symbol in the Bias column next to the bias area. This displays a red — symbol, which indicates a negative bias.
  9. To see how the new constraint alters routing and congestion, click the ECO button in the Global Bias Setup form.
    Alternatively, choose Global Route and ECO Congestion Analysis from the drop-down list.

Related Topics

How do I use global bias constraints to plan routing?

How do I create a global bias positive region constraint?

How do I create a global bias path constraint?

How do I create multiple global bias constraints for specific layers?




 ⠀
X